Central had to travel to play their first game of the season, but the final result was worth the trip. They came out on top in a nail-biter against the Rock Springs TIGERS on Thursday, sneaking past 51-48. The victory continues a trend for the Indians in their matchups with the TIGERS: they've now won nine in a row.
Despite the loss, Rock Springs still got an impressive performance from Boston James, who shot 46% from the field to rack up 18 points in addition to five boards and three steals. James has been hot, having posted two or more steals the last five times he's played. Antonio Cortez was another key player, putting up six points along with five rebounds and three steals.
Central has already played their next game, a 74-56 win against Evanston on the 12th. As for Rock Springs, they also wasted no time getting back out on the court and have already played their next matchup, a 55-54 victory against East on the 12th.
